Output 7a520ca22ee0430fcf0589c54e18fde9eee1091c888fe94e8970377136c38e21:1

value
608294
script pubkey
OP_0 OP_PUSHBYTES_20 26886e5f5f2539f5525a218190771e05f7796ece
address
bc1qy6yxuh6ly5ul25j6yxqeqac7qhmhjmkwm89qan
transaction
7a520ca22ee0430fcf0589c54e18fde9eee1091c888fe94e8970377136c38e21
confirmations
152487
spent
true